Example #1
0
        public TextureCoordinate Clone()
        {
            TextureCoordinate textureCoordinate = new TextureCoordinate();

            textureCoordinate.Point = Point;
            return(textureCoordinate);
        }
Example #2
0
        public IndexedFaceSet Clone()
        {
            IndexedFaceSet clone = new IndexedFaceSet();

            clone.Index             = Index;
            clone.CoordIndex        = CoordIndex;
            clone.TextCoordIndex    = TextCoordIndex;
            clone.Normal            = Normal == null ? null : Normal.Clone();
            clone.Coordinate        = Coordinate == null ? null : Coordinate.Clone();
            clone.TextureCoordinate = TextureCoordinate == null ? null : TextureCoordinate.Clone();
            foreach (var text2d in MultiTextureCoordinate)
            {
                clone.MultiTextureCoordinate.Add(text2d.Clone());
            }
            return(clone);
        }